Amerischools Academy - Yuma, located in Yuma, Arizona, is a charter school that serves grades PK-5. It has received a GreatSchools rating of 5 out of 10 based on its performance on state standardized tests.

Student Growth 9/10 The Student Progress Rating measures whether students at this school are making academic progress over time based on student growth data provided by the Department of Education. Specifically, this rating looks at how much progress individual students have made on state assessments during the past year or more, how this performance aligns with expected progress based on a student growth model established by the state Department of Education, and how this school's growth data compares to other schools in the state. The Growth Rating was created using 2025 Student growth data from Arizona Department of Education.

My children have been attending Amerischools Academy South in Yuma for 3 years now, and I couldn't be happier with my decision to send them to this charter school. My daughter attended Kindergarten at a public school before she came here and unlike the public school, Amerischools caps the classes at 24 students. The principal, Mrs. Fox, is amazing. She strikes the perfect balance between strict and loving, and she takes the time to know each of the children in her care, as well as their parents. This attitude is passed down to her teachers, who also take the time to learn the name of all the students in the school while still focusing attention on those children in their care. The teachers take the time to challenge all of the students. The school offers physical education, music, art, computers, and other classes that were cut out of the public school. There are also clubs offered after school, at no charge, to help students grow and explore- dance, Spanish, and board games are just a few of the options. I wish the school was more than K-6 so I could leave my children in this perfect learning environment even longer. If you are looking for a school in Yuma, look no further.
